European Commission President von der Leyen: €11bn 10th round of sanctions on Iran and Russia including all tech products found on the battle field.

Electronic components for drones and helicopters; spare parts for trucks and jet engines; construction equipment that could be turned to military uses.

Proposes to out their propagandists. Not sure what that accomplishes, but yes let's do.

Targets oligarchs' hidden accounts to fund reconstruction.

@Queasy Happened routinely during WWII, including against white NCOs of African American regiments. Army never stepped in, quite the contrary.

Racial epithets and threats of violence were part of daily life on Southern military bases, and off base, African Americans were restricted to the "Black" sections of town.

"If they stepped even a foot outside of that, they were threatened or attacked by white police or sheriffs," Delmont says.
